
Rusty & Terry come as a pair - but you know what they say about double the love and double the fun! These sweet-natured boys are easy, good natured dogs who are happiest when they are together. For awhile it seemed like their dream of being together would never come true - they were abandoned in a park & picked up by the local police department & later transferred to the county shelter, where they were immediately separated because nobody informed shelter staff they belonged together. For 2 long months they endured the stress & the anxiety of the noisy shelter, not knowing where their beloved brother was. Luckily the member of the public who had found them in the park reached out, told us their story & enabled us to reunite them in a foster home together. Rusty and Terry love other dogs and are very playful. They enjoy toys and they are extremely joyful when a new toy is given. They wear their gratitude on their sleeve. Because they are so used to being together adopting them is really like adopting one dog . They are absolutely amazing dogs - warm, loving and affectionate. They are true gems.
